First of all a piece of Chromatography paper was taken and a line was drawn 2 cm above the bottom of the page. This was the origin line. On this line 10 crosses were drawn which would be the starting point of the samples. This paper was measured so that it would fit into the Chromatography tank. After this the Chromatography paper was laid down and 6 drops of the appropriate solution i.e. Aspartic acid was added using a capillary tube.
